Merry Christmas Cardinal

Following along with this week's challenge over at The Character Cafe, I have used the lovely Cardinal Birdhouse image.  Be sure to pop over and see what the DT has created this week, and find a few ideas for those cards that you still have to make!

This time around, I have coloured with Prismas but I've added some Tombow marker to give me the bright red for the Cardinal.  The background has been sponged with blue distress ink, plus I've added a bit of stamped greenery.  For the snow, I've used liquid applique and then clear stickles.  

Using my Nestie die, I've cut a frame from navy cardstock, adding some doodling and red pearls.  Behind two of the corners are some large corner pieces, made on my Silhouette, which are covered completely with copper stickles....lots of sparkle and a touch of vintage!

The DP is a burlap pattern, which I have stamped over with a black tree design.  The flower is from Fred She Said, one that you just print and cut, and for the leaves I have used punches.
